There are a lot of people earning around that or less. It might lead you onto other things. When I wanted a career change at thirty years of age I had to take a lower paid job to gain experience.

 

I took a sales support job in a call centre about nine years ago as a stepping stone to a customer facing sales role. Six years later I started my own business and wish I had done it sooner.

 

A higher salary doesn't make you happy although it can help. You can't buy experience.
